In the Linux kernel, the following vulnerability has been resolved:
asix: fix uninit-value in asixmdioread()
asixreadcmd() may read less than sizeof(smsr) bytes and in this case smsr will be uninitialized.
Fail log: BUG: KMSAN: uninit-value in asixcheckhostenable drivers/net/usb/asixcommon.c:82 [inline] BUG: KMSAN: uninit-value in asixcheckhostenable drivers/net/usb/asixcommon.c:82 [inline] drivers/net/usb/asixcommon.c:497 BUG: KMSAN: uninit-value in asixmdioread+0x3c1/0xb00 drivers/net/usb/asixcommon.c:497 drivers/net/usb/asixcommon.c:497 asixcheckhostenable drivers/net/usb/asixcommon.c:82 [inline] asixcheckhostenable drivers/net/usb/asixcommon.c:82 [inline] drivers/net/usb/asixcommon.c:497 asixmdioread+0x3c1/0xb00 drivers/net/usb/asixcommon.c:497 drivers/net/usb/asixcommon.c:497